Monument Mining Ltd. V.MMY

Alternate Symbol(s):  MMTMF

Monument Mining Limited is a Canada-based gold producer. The Company is engaged in the operation of gold mines, acquisition, exploration, and development of precious metals with a focus on gold. It owns a 100% interest in the Selinsing Gold Mine and the Murchison Gold Project. The Selinsing Gold Mine is located in Pahang State, within the Central Gold Belt of Western Malaysia, and comprises the Selinsing, Buffalo Reef, Felda Land, Peranggih and Famehub projects. Buffalo Reef lies continuously and contiguously along the gold trend upon which the Selinsing Gold Property is located. Both Felda and Famehub are located east and north of the Selinsing and Buffalo Reef properties. It has a 100% interest in the Murchison Gold Portfolio, which consists of the Burnakura, Gabanintha, and a 20% interest in Tuckanarra gold properties, located in the Murchison Mineral Field. Burnakura and Gabanintha are located southeast of Meekatharra, Western Australia and northeast of Perth, Western Australia.

RC DRILLING RECOMMENCES AT THE TUCKANARRA PROJECT WITH VISIBLE GOLD INTERSECTED
Highlights
• A 12-hole reverse circulation (“RC”) drilling program comprising 1,260m is underway at the T8 Target located within the Tuckanarra Project in WA
 
• Visible gold intersected in 2 of the first 3 holes drilled
 
• Gold anomalism previously defined over 300m of strike from surface sampling, including
130m of strike from historic drilling including aircore results of:
 
o 20m@2.4g/tAufrom8mincluding8m@5.0g/tfrom8mi
o 6m@4.0g/tAufrom20mii
 
• Current drilling should allow rapid addition of open pit resources to the current 5.32Mt @
2.2g/t Au for 376koz Mineral Resource estimate
 
• Potential 100m strike extension to the east identified in historic surface samples.
 
• Target T8 is located on a new mining lease granted in July 2023
 
• Historic production from adjacent Kohinoor deposit reported to be 166kt at 5.5g/t Au for 29koz
 
• Multiple shallow oxide targets in the area with potential high-grade extensions
 
Odyssey Gold Limited (ASX:ODY) (“Odyssey” or “Company”) is pleased to announce the commencement of reverse circulation drilling at T8 target located within the Stakewell JV at Odyssey’s Tuckanarra Project in the Murchison Goldfields of Western Australia.
 
Commenting on this intersection, Director, Matt Briggs said:
“RC drilling has recently commenced with visible gold being observed in 2 of the first 3 holes. The intersection of visible gold in RC drilling demonstrates targeted systematic exploration can continue to add shallow oxide open pit resources.

There are numerous shallow oxide projects and potential underground extensions on the project warranting drilling such as the T8 Target.
 
“This target has historic RAB, aircore and RC drilling, however this spacing, drill method and orientation of this drilling did not allow for the inclusion of the target in the July 2023 resource.
 
“Additional data review as part of the resource documentation exposed a line of surface samples with anomalism to the east was identified that was not in the database. These samples suggest a strike extension to the east along with an undrilled parallel structure 500m to the south.”
